Solar panels can increase the value of your home by 3-4%

Installing a solar power system can add up to 3-4% to the value of a home, according to a study by Wells Fargo Bank and the Journal of Appraisers in San Antonio. Reduced utility bills are an attractive proposition for home-buyers, and can add an average $9,000 to the sale price of a property.

The Australia Bureau of Statistics (ABS) reported that the average Australian house price rose by 2.6% during the previous year to Q1 2013, the rise coming on the back of lower interest rates and improving affordability. The Real Estate Institute of Australia reported a similar rise with the median value of residential properties rising 4%.

By fitting solar panels to a residential rooftop, home-owners not only enjoy an increase in the value of their investment, but help reduce the need for coal and gas in power generation thus reducing greenhouse gases emissions and air pollution.

Installing solar panels

As well as being eco-friendly and cost effective they require very little maintenance and high quality solar panels are rated to produce 80% of their capacity for twenty five years after their installation.

An average 3kW solar power system can pay for itself within five years through energy savings and government feed-in tariffs. Most households can expect a saving of around $1100 per year, while reducing the amount of greenhouse gas produced by more than 5.5 tonnes.

Solar Hot Water systems can also be installed to help reduce energy costs. Using evacuated tubes rather than traditional flat panel technologies improves efficiency and require as much as 80% less energy than standard systems.
